Here are some low-budget private colleges in India offering BAMS (Bachelor of Ayurvedic Medicine and Surgery):
-
Many private BAMS colleges in states like Rajasthan, Gujarat, Madhya Pradesh, and Uttar Pradesh have affordable fees ranging from Rs. 50,000 to Rs. 1,50,000 per year.

Fees depend on state regulations, infrastructure, and recognition by the Central Council of Indian Medicine (CCIM).
You can apply through state-level counseling or direct admission if seats remain vacant.
Always check that the college is recognized by CCIM and affiliated with a reputable university.
To find the best low-budget BAMS college, research colleges in your preferred state, contact them directly for fee details, and verify their accreditation.
